Dominion Energy offers other programs to eligible residential electric and natural gas customers to help decrease energy use:

  • Home Energy Check-up provides a free consultation and assessment by an energy expert for customers' homes, along with recommendations on how to enhance energy efficiency.
  • EnergyWise Online Savings Store offers instant discounts on a variety of Energy Star-certified products like smart thermostats, advanced power strips, water-saving products, weatherization kits and more.
  • Heating & Cooling Equipment Program offers customers rebates up to $750 for installing new Energy Star-qualified central air conditioning systems, heat pumps and heat pump water heaters that replace older equipment, as well as making ductwork improvements in existing residences.
  • Natural Gas Fireplace Rebate is available to eligible customers looking to upgrade their existing natural gas fireplace to a direct vent system with electric pilot ignition.
  • Natural Gas Water Heater Rebate, up to $350, are available when eligible customers purchase and install an Energy Star-certified natural gas water heater.
  • Natural Gas Furnace Rebate, up to $350, are available to eligible customers who purchase and install an Energy Star-certified natural gas furnace.

Energy-saving programs are also available for eligible Dominion Energy non-residential and business customers:

  • Small Business Energy Solutions provides incentives for certain energy-efficient upgrades to refrigeration, lighting and HVAC system improvements, including a free on-site energy analysis. Incentives cover 90% of project costs up to $6,000. This program is available to small business and nonprofit customers with five or fewer Dominion Energy electric accounts and an annual energy use of 350,000 kilowatt-hours or less.
  • EnergyWise for Your Business provides financial incentives to reduce the upfront costs of energy-efficiency improvements with an annual cap of $100,000 per project type each program year. Project types include Lighting, HVAC, Food Service and Custom.
  • Natural Gas Commercial Incentives are available to qualifying natural gas customers to include natural gas water heaters, heat and food service equipment.

About Dominion Energy
Dominion Energy (NYSE: D), headquartered in Richmond, Va., provides regulated electricity service to 3.6 million homes and businesses in Virginia, North Carolina, and South Carolina, and regulated natural gas service to 400,000 customers in South Carolina. The company is one of the nation's leading developers and operators of regulated offshore wind and solar power and the largest producer of carbon-free electricity in New England.
